A few words about Lazise

 

Lazise is a small town that is particularly popular with tourists visiting Lake Garda. Founded by the ancient Romans during the Middle Ages, it became the first free commune in Italy and in the 10th century it became very important from a commercial point of view.

Its oldest core dates back to the Middle Ages and is surrounded by walls erected by the Scaligeri family in the 14th century. Lazise and its hamlets are also home to numerous Renaissance villas (the Moscardo and Da Sacco villas in Colà, Villa De Beni in Pacengo) and 19th-century romantic villas (the Buri, Pergolana, Bagatta and Bottona villas in Lazise, Villa Alberti in Pacengo, the Fumanelli and Cedri villas in Colà). These are private homes that cannot be visited inside, but some are partially visible from the outside.

A few words about Garda Island

 

The Island – one kilometre in length – is the largest in the whole of Lake Garda and is located in San Felice del Benaco, in the province of Brescia. Its history is fascinating to say the least, since it has been a refuge for pirates, a place where monks devoted themselves to prayer and the headquarters of the Savoy soldiers. And, St Francis of Assisi, St Anthony of Padua and Dante Alighieri have also passed through here.

After many vicissitudes, Isola del Garda became the property of the Cavazza family, which has been organising guided tours since 2001 to show tourists the beauty of the Venetian neo-Gothic style villa, combined with the lush greenery of the park and the different plant species in the Italian and English gardens.
